Your tasks
- Your mission consists in designing, commissioning and maintaining RF sub-systems for the company’s satellite ground segment activities:
- Perform RF system specification, design, and in-factory and on-site acceptance testing activities related to large satellite communication antennas (including reflector and feed subsystems, LNAs, HPAs, up-and down-converters and baseband equipment)
- Participate in the specification, selection, and testing of sub-contractor deliveries and COTS equipment related to ground station antennas and active/ passive RF components
- Start up and commission RF and baseband commercial and internal equipment
- Design, develop, and maintain scripting software and related interfaces for test automation and monitoring and control
- Perform RF/ physical optics simulations of antenna systems
Your profile
- Bachelor’s or master’s degree in electrical engineering, telecommunications or RF engineering or equivalent
- Good general knowledge of passive RF systems, such as feeds, waveguides, diplexers, and filters, and of active RF components, such as LNAs, HPAs, up-and down-converters, baseband equipment
- Hands-on experiece with RF-related testing concepts and equipment, such as spectrum and vector network analysers
- Basic skills in the following fields: Classical and scientific programming and scripting languages (Java, C++, Matlab or Python), Communication networks and protocols (TCP/IP, field buses)
- Experience with the software package GRASP (or equivalent) is considered a plus
- Know-how in software-defined radio and digital signal-processing is considered a plus
